How they compare
Italy currently reports 0.0007 t per person against 0.0006 t per person in Romania, a difference of 0.0001 t per person.
That makes Italy's figure about 1.1 times Romania's.
The two have swapped places 6 times across 31 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Italy ahead.
Italy ranks 25th and Romania ranks 28th of 179 countries.
Italy has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
